Homemade Pan De Sal

November 21, 2010June 11, 2012 molagueramtlLeave a comment

When I was little, one of life’s great pleasures was to be allowed to ride my bicycle a few blocks to the neighbourhood bakery, where you could buy Spanish bread, coconut buns, egg pies….or a brown paper bagful of hot pan de sal. The words hot pan de sal are enough to make any Filipino’s… Continue reading Homemade Pan De Sal
